Output 5c12f50bfa12f7eef367273f91f9b00632ae5a5588a2e3ea52a7724fd6665211:5

value
306383300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f4fa2e63fc3308edb8cb560dea92b9598af1757 OP_EQUAL
address
MDfvCk8WDYb9cXAyTS8AtibUS8J4qXxwka
transaction
5c12f50bfa12f7eef367273f91f9b00632ae5a5588a2e3ea52a7724fd6665211
spent
true